Mary and Sara Ervin have been crafting hand-made organic chocolate confections and bean to bar chocolate in Woodstock, Illinois, as Ethereal Confections since 2011.

Ethereal's Madagascar chocolate bar was made from all organic ingredients: cacao beans, cane sugar, and cocoa butter. Cocoa solids (cacao beans and cocoa butter) made up 80%, with the remaining 20% being cane sugar.

Inside a thick paper wrap that was sealed with the label, the 2.25 ounce bar came wrapped in pink colored foil . The label also adhered to the foil wrapping along the bottom edge, which made removing the chocolate without breaking the bar a bit challenging. The best before date was September 28, 2017.

The bar was scored into 24 pieces. The chocolate had a smooth surface, with an uneven sheen, some adhered bits, and a few bubbles. The underside was shaped with a thin protruding edge. The chocolate had a medium brown Fudgesickle (PANTONE 19-1431) color.

Madagascar had a medium hard snap. The aroma revealed scents of earth, and hay in particular, a smoky roast, fruit, and spice. The fruit scent included raisin and coconut.

The chocolate tasted primarily of fruit, with flavors of citrus, plum, lime and blueberry. In addition, I tasted earth, a cocoa and smoky roast, and sweetness. Some tannin was also present.

The melt had a less smooth texture, but no graininess. The chocolate flavor lasted about 15 to 20 seconds after the chocolate was gone, giving a short length. The finish was somewhat acidic and somewhat tannin.

Overall, a good chocolate with delicious fruit flavors. For me, the texture needs improvement, but if you enjoy Madagascar interpretations with this flavor profile, give this chocolate a try.

Northwest Chocolate Festival Awards

The awards were announced tonight for the 2015 Northwest Chocolate Festival. There were three judged categories (Single Origin, Milk Chocolate and Inclusions) and three non-judged awards.

In the judged Single Origin category, the winners were:
  • 1st: Fruition Hispaniola 68% (Dominican Republic)
  • 2nd: Dick Taylor Bolivia Alto Beni 70%
  • 3rd: Amano Guayas 70% (Ecuador)

In the judged Milk Chocolate category, the winner was:
  • Sirene Guatemala

In the judged Inclusions (flavored chocolate) category, the winners were:
  • 1st: Fruition Bourbon Aged Dark Milk 61%
  • 2nd: Amano Red Raspberry
  • 3rd: Fruition Brown Butter Milk 43%

Event: Seattle Craft Chocolate Week

Craft Chocolate Week is a new series of events coordinated around the huge presence of artisan chocolate makers in Seattle during the Northwest Chocolate Festival. There are five limited attendance events to provide a more intimate and interactive experience than the crowded activities of a typical chocolate festival. Barbie Van Horn of Finding Fine Chocolate has generously given us four promo codes to share with you for discounts at these events.

  • Tue, Sep. 29: Wine and Chocolate Pairing with Adam Dick and Dustin Taylor at Chocolat Vitale. Taste a flight of three French wines from H Wines paired with three bean to bar chocolates. Talk with Adam Dick and Dustin Taylor of Dick Taylor Chocolate. $20 after $10 off promo code vitale.
  • Wed, Sep. 30: New Cacao Origin with David Menkes and Tesla Test Rides at Seattle Tesla. Taste a new origin of cacao and converse with David Menkes of LetterPress. Meet the farm manager who grows this rare cacao. Take a test ride in a Tesla. $25 after $15 off promo code tesla.
  • Mon, Oct 5: Craft Beer and Chocolate Pairing with Clay Gordon at Kakao. Learn how to pair beer and chocolate using the concept of simultaneous contrast with Clay Gordon of The Chocolate Life. $25 after $25 off promo code kakao.
  • Fri, Oct 9: Coffee and Chocolate Pairing with Aaron Barthel of Intrigue Chocolate. Taste pairings of chocolate and coffee, and enjoy Aaron Barthel's French style truffles. $25 after $5 off promo code intrigue.
  • Sat, Oct 10: Understanding Craft Chocolate with Rob Anderson at Chocolat Vitale. Experience chocolate at different stages of production to learn about the steps of chocolate-making with Rob Anderson of Fresco. Taste how origin, roasting, and recipes affect the flavors of chocolate. $25.
